1.) Understanding Prompt Engineering




Prompt engineering refers to the practice of guiding or influencing an AI system's behavior by providing it with specific inputs called "prompts." These prompts can be textual, visual, or even behavioral, serving as a bridge between humans and machines in their interaction. The quality and specificity of these prompts significantly affect the output generated by AI systems.




2.) Linguistic Influences on Prompt Engineering




1. Semantic Understanding


One of the fundamental aspects that linguistic theory provides is semantic understanding. This involves knowing what words mean, how they relate to one another, and their implications in different contexts. In prompt engineering, this means crafting questions or inputs that are clear and unambiguous, allowing AI models to understand user intent accurately. For instance, a well-crafted prompt can steer the AI towards generating relevant responses based on its training data but tailored to specific needs.

2. Syntax and Structure


Syntax refers to the arrangement of words in sentences, while structure pertains to how parts of speech are organized within a sentence or paragraph. Understanding syntax and structure helps in structuring prompts that guide AI systems through logical sequences of thought, ensuring coherence and effectiveness in communication. For example, organizing thoughts with proper grammar can lead to more accurate outputs from AI models designed for natural language processing.

3. Pragmatics


Pragmatics deals with the use of language in context, considering not just what is said but also how it is interpreted depending on the situation and the speaker’s intentions. In prompt engineering, this means adapting prompts to suit different scenarios or user contexts. For example, providing real-time data analysis or scenario-based inputs can help AI models provide more contextually relevant outputs.




3.) Applications in Software Development




1. Enhancing User Interfaces


In software development, effective use of linguistics in prompt engineering helps in creating intuitive and interactive interfaces that are user-friendly. By understanding how users interact with language, developers can design prompts that guide users through complex applications smoothly. This not only improves user experience but also reduces the learning curve for new users.

2. Tailoring AI Models


Developers use linguistic insights to fine-tune AI models by providing them with tailored datasets and prompts. These inputs help in training the model more efficiently, allowing it to perform specific tasks better. For example, a customer support chatbot can be trained using conversational data that mirrors natural human interactions, enhancing its ability to understand and respond appropriately to user inquiries.

3. Personalization of Experiences


By leveraging linguistic insights into user preferences and behaviors through prompts, developers can personalize software experiences for individual users or groups. This involves understanding the nuances of language use among different demographics, which then helps in tailoring content and interactions according to these specificities.




4.) Challenges and Considerations




1. Model Limitations


While linguistic insights are invaluable in prompt engineering, AI models have their limitations. Linguistic analysis must be combined with continuous model refinement and real-time feedback mechanisms to adapt to new patterns and nuances in language use.

2. Ethical Implications


The implications of using linguistic prompts extend beyond technical challenges. There are ethical considerations regarding the misuse of language, especially in AI that interacts with humans, which must be carefully managed by developers to prevent harm or bias.
